VERA Therapeutics experienced a sharp stock surge on FDA review progress for atacicept, its dual inhibitor targeting APRIL and BAFF โ two cytokines implicated in IgA nephropathy (IgAN), a progressive kidney disease with limited treatment options. IgAN has emerged as one of the most actively targeted indications in nephrology, following the approval of several competing therapies including Calliditas's Tarpeyo and Travere's Filspari. Atacicept's differentiated mechanism โ simultaneously blocking both the complement and B-cell pathways โ has generated substantial clinical interest, and FDA engagement at this stage signals the agency is actively reviewing the company's data package with constructive intent.
The price-to-sales valuation signal emerging from this move is analytically important. When a biotech stock surges on FDA review news, the price-to-sales multiple โ particularly when applied to current or near-term revenue run-rates โ can appear extreme. However, for disease-modifying IgAN therapies in particular, the long-term patient revenue potential is substantial: IgAN affects approximately 130,000 newly diagnosed patients annually in the US, treatment durations are multi-year or lifelong, and pricing for approved kidney disease therapies has demonstrated the ability to command five- to six-figure annual treatment costs. The current valuation is therefore forward-looking, and the FDA review pace determines how quickly that revenue potential materializes.
Forward signals center on FDA action dates, advisory committee decisions, and atacicept's Phase 3 clinical data readouts. The competitive landscape in IgAN is intensifying, with Novartis, AstraZeneca, and Chinook all advancing compounds, meaning VERA's first-mover advantage timeline is finite. If FDA approval arrives ahead of competitive completions, VERA captures commercial ground before the market crowds. Watch for any PDUFA target action date disclosure, clinical trial data updates that strengthen the efficacy and safety profile, and any commercial partnership discussions that could validate the program's value and reduce VERA's single-asset concentration risk.
